Dialectical Behavioral Therapy
A type of cognitive-behavioral therapy that emphasizes the psychosocial aspects of treatment, focusing on the development of coping skills to manage emotional distress and improve interpersonal relationships.
Maladaptive Behaviors
Actions or tendencies that inhibit an individual's ability to adjust healthily to particular situations.
Disorders
Conditions characterized by disruption of normal functioning in the body or mind, leading to distress or impaired function.
Cross-Cultural Treatment
Therapeutic approaches or interventions that take into account the cultural backgrounds and practices of patients to provide effective care.
